Overnight Herb and Beer Shrimp
OtherSeafoodEasyBy Northstar
Ingredients
Servings
4
- 2 lb peeled raw shrimp
- 1 0.5 cup dark beer
- 2 count c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tbsp fresh chives, snipped
- 2 tbsp fresh parsley, snipped
- 1 0.5 tsp salt
- 0.5 tsp black pepper
- 2 cup shredded lettuce for serving
- 2 count green onions, finely chopped
Instructions
- 1
Combine shrimp, beer, minced garlic, chives, parsley, salt, and pepper in a large bowl. Stir to coat shrimp well.
- 2
Cover and refrigerate overnight, stirring occasionally.
- 3
When ready to cook, drain shrimp and reserve the marinade.
- 4
Preheat broiler. Arrange shrimp on a broiler pan and broil 4 inches from the heat for about 2 minutes per side, brushing occasionally with the reserved marinade. Do not overcook.
- 5
Serve shrimp on a bed of shredded lettuce, sprinkled with chopped green onion.
